An Alabama megachurch has voted to leave the United Methodist Church due to concerns over the apparent theological direction of the mainline Protestant denomination. It included the fact that some bishops were refusing to enforce the UMC Book of Discipline’s rules prohibiting the ordination of noncelibate homosexuals and the blessing of same-sex unions. Between 55 and 60 congregations out of the approximately 600 congregations are seeking to leave the denomination.
